
Gore Park lights soon

Christmas in Gore Park begins Dec. 5. In conjunction with the Downtown Hamilton BIA, the City of Hamilton is organizing the official Light Up Ceremony.
Youngsters can also bring their letters to put in Santa’s mailbox. The miniature train and full-sized Christmas merry-go-round which will be in the park until Dec. 23.
Kids can have their free picture taken with Santa Claus at the Park and enjoy a trolley ride Downtown on Saturday, Dec. 6 from 11 a. m. until 3 p. m.
Free two-hour parking will be available at on-street meters downtown from Nov. 24 to Dec. 24.
